Does Pine-Sol contain vinegar or bleach?

No, Pine-Sol does not contain vinegar or bleach. You can add a little vinegar to a diluted solution of Pine-Sol. This combination will clean more effectively. The vinegar also adds an extra shine to the surfaces. But never add bleach to Pine-Sol cleaner. The bleach will interact with the chemicals to form very strong chlorine gas.

Is Pine Sol a good floor cleaner?

For routine mopping, Pine-Sol is generally the better choice. It’s effective at cleaning and deodorizing floors without being as harsh as bleach. Pine-Sol is safe for use on most floor types, including tile, linoleum, and sealed hardwood. It leaves a pleasant scent and doesn’t pose the same risks of discoloration or damage that bleach might.
